Summary:

Arranges referral appointments for specialists utilizing managed care guidelines and practices. Maintains working knowledge of, and adheres to compliance with, Medicare, Medicaid, and managed care regulations.

CHRISTUS Spohn Family Health Centers -Westside is a an outpatient department and provider- based facility associated with CHRISTUS Spohn Hospital Corpus Christi - Memorial supported by two contracted, board certified Family Physicians, a mid-level Family Nurse Practitioner, and a Dentist.It is centrally located at 4617 Greenwood Dr. Corpus Christi, Texas 78416.The clinic zip code is federally designated as a medically underserved area. The Center offers acute and chronic ambulatory health care along with preventive medicine and patient education.The department is supported by 10 associates, 4 clerical and 6 clinical staff for the providers.The hours of operation are: Medical clinic - 8:00 AM - 5:00 PM Monday - Friday; Dental clinic -- 11:00 AM - 5:00 PM Monday - Friday

The Center health care team is organized to deliver timely, appropriate ambulatory services to patients and their families.The following goals summarize the elements key to its operation:

  • To provide an alternative to the Emergency Room for non-emergent health care
  • To improve access to health care for under-served populations and/or areas.
  • To provide primary care services to families, regardless of payor class.
  • To maintain a continuum of care when patients for patients needing specialty and hospital care.

Requirements:
  • High school diploma or equivalent required
  • Knowledge of medical terminology and CPT, ICD9 and HCPCS coding required
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ills with the ability to communicate with all types of people and perform under stressful conditions.
  • Knowledge of managed care contracts preferred
  • Excellent time management and organizational skills
  • Demonstrated advanced computer skills with various software programs, such as Microsoft Outlook, Word, Excel and other department specific programs
  • Must be able to follow detailed instructions and perform repetitious tasks
  • Computer basic keyboard skills, telephone skills and general knowledge of office machines including printers, copier, scanner, and credit card machines required
  • One year of experience in a medical office setting preferred.
  • Previous experience with appointment systems in a physician's office or other outpatient health care facility.
  • Previous office experience required.
  • Knowledge of basic medical terminology required.
  • Bilingual in English/Spanish preferred.
